深入浅出C语言教程,带你轻松掌握编程技巧

作者:泰安淘贝游戏开发公司 阅读:118 次 发布时间:2023-05-15 16:06:04

摘要:  C语言是广泛使用的一种计算机编程语言,被视为学习编程的入门课程。它被广泛应用于开发计算机和嵌入式系统,而且学习它的好处还不止于此。  众所周知,编程不仅仅是一种技术,更是一种生活方式。它可以帮助你提高解决问题的能力,并让你学会如何将想法转化为实际应用。...

  C语言是广泛使用的一种计算机编程语言,被视为学习编程的入门课程。它被广泛应用于开发计算机和嵌入式系统,而且学习它的好处还不止于此。

深入浅出C语言教程,带你轻松掌握编程技巧

  众所周知,编程不仅仅是一种技术,更是一种生活方式。它可以帮助你提高解决问题的能力,并让你学会如何将想法转化为实际应用。如果想让自己成为一个优秀的程序开发者,C语言是必须掌握的一门语言。

  在本文中,将向大家介绍C语言教程,让每一个人都可以轻松地学习C语言,掌握编程技能。

  1. C语言基础知识入门

  C语言是一种过程性语言,主要用于系统软件和应用程序的编写。在学习C语言的过程中,需要学习的第一个知识点就是里面的基础语法和数据类型。

  在这个阶段,需要理解和掌握以下几个概念:

  1.1 变量和数据类型

  变量就是指在程序中用来存储数据的一种空间,而数据类型则说明变量中存储的数据的类型,有char、int、float、double等。

  1.2 运算符与表达式

  运算符是一种可以对数据进行操作的符号,在C语言中常见的运算符有算术运算符、关系运算符、逻辑运算符和赋值运算符。

  表达式是由变量、常量和运算符等构成的一个式子,它可以进行运算,运算结果也可以再次作为表达式的一部分。

  1.3 控制语句

  在编写程序时,可能会遇到需要判断、控制程序运行流程的情况,此时就需要使用控制语句。在C语言中,常用的控制语句有if-else语句、for循环和while循环语句等。

  2. C语言高级应用与进阶

  学习完C语言的基础知识后,就可以开始学习高级应用与进阶内容。

  2.1 函数的使用

  C语言中的函数是一种组织好的、可重用的代码块,可以将它们作为一个单元来进行调用,函数的使用可以使程序更加简洁,易于维护与管理。

  2.2 数组与指针

  C语言中的数组和指针,在实现一些功能上可以起到非常重要的作用。数组是一种被定义为一个集合的值的连续区域,指针则对应着数组中的某个元素的地址。

  2.3 结构体的应用

  结构体是一种用户自定义的数据类型,可以将不同类型的变量组合在一起来定义一个结构体变量,从而方便了数据的管理和处理。

  3. C语言实战与案例分析

  在学习C语言的过程中,一个好的方法就是通过实际的案例来学习,这可以帮助我们更快更深入地理解。

  3.1 系统开发

  C语言的应用非常广泛,可以用于开发各种类型的系统软件,如操作系统、编译器、数据库等。学习C语言后,就可以轻松地开发各种系统软件。

  3.2 游戏开发

  C语言也可以应用于游戏开发领域,通过掌握C语言的开发技巧,可以开发出丰富多彩的游戏,为玩家带来更加优秀的游戏体验。

  4. 学习C语言技巧

  学习C语言不仅要掌握其基础和高级应用,还应掌握一些方法和技巧,以便更加高效地学习。

  4.1 坚持编写代码

  编写代码是学习C语言的最好方法,只有通过亲自编写代码,才能够快速提高编程技能。

  4.2 深入理解代码

  学习C语言并不是写出一堆代码就可以掌握的,要理解代码的实现过程,才能更深入地掌握技术。

  4.3 多看资料

  学习C语言需要不断查阅相关资料,提高自己的知识储备,了解各种知识的新进展,从而加强自己的学习效果。

  总体来说,学习C语言需要掌握一些基础的理论知识,同时也需要实践和实战经验。只要掌握了以上生活,就能够轻松地掌握编程技能。无论是从事编程工程师的工作,还是为了提高自己的解决问题的能力,学习C语言都是非常有用的一门技术,可以为您带来很多乐趣和收获。

  • 原标题:深入浅出C语言教程,带你轻松掌握编程技巧

  • 本文链接:https://qipaikaifa1.com/tb/1704.html

  • 本文由泰安淘贝游戏开发公司小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与淘贝科技联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:189-2934-0276


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部